Ahead of the Reddit IPO, former Reddit CEO Ellen Pao discusses the platform’s reliance on Reddit users and its data-selling strategy for profitability as a public company. Plus, she weighs in on the dangers of unchecked online forums, suggesting that TikTok may be one of multiple national security risks. Also online, entrepreneur Sonny Caberwal is attempting to use social media AI algorithms for good; his app Legends builds confidence in young internet users before they develop mental health issues from negativity online.
